Knowing that extracting pages from a pdf on a mac is not quite as straightforward without our tool. Extract pdf pages and rename based on text in each page. Note, this package only works if the pdf s text is highlightable if its typed i. Heres a small python script using the pypdf library that does the job neatly. Hi, do we have support in the python tika to extract pdf on page level. You can specify the separator, default separator is any whitespace. Split pdf into single files using python cbse today. After the billing cycles exhausted, the subscription will be cancelled. This program is required my all of us to split pdf files into multiple files, this is one such task that all of us do. You will learn how to read and extract the content both text and images, rotate single pages, and split documents into its individual pages. This functions perfectly as your best online pdf split tool. I am combining several word documents to create a staff procedural manual in adobe acrobat x pro 10. You may also combine split and merge actions in one flow to collect key pages.
Yes, ive got a total of 25 pages in this pdf, however, the document size changes drastically. You can select the number of pages, as well as the order in. In this case i am taking it a little step further and will create a multi page pdf file that will contain 6 graphs on each page base on a combination of suggestions made at this page. For this example, we need to import both the pdffilereader and the pdffilewriter. You can use php exec function to run these commands, ie. Split pdf to individual pages using fpdi and fpdf github. Specifies the separator to use when splitting the string. Click split pdf, wait for the process to finish and download.
The video uses the pypdf2 which is a very useful module to handle pdf files. Make sure its added to your path so you can call it from the command line. While the pdf was originally invented by adobe, it is now an open standard that is maintained by the international organization for standardization iso. The reason is i had the exact same issue as i think you are facing. Patrick maupin created a package he called pdfrw and released it back in 2012. The process is just as simple, no matter where you store the files.
You scanned a book by taking out the middle ligature clips and feeding the double pages into a scanner. Getting data from pdfs the easy way with r open source. I split the pdf into number of partitions as mentioned above. Using it you can pick single pages or ranges of pages from a pdf document and store them in a new pdf document.
Should be true if the existing addons should be replaced with the ones that are being passed. The following code worked very well for me when i tried to read a regular web page, but it prints all kinds of weird letters when i try it on a pdf page like this one. You can use any of our tools, in addition to our pdf separator, at any time, all for free. Adobe acrobat, adobe framemaker, adobe indesign, adobe photoshop.
Creating and manipulating pdfs with pdfrw the mouse vs. Hosted pages are the easiest and most secure way to integrate chargebee with your website. Pdf shuffler is a small python gtk application, which helps the user to merge or split pdf documents and rotate, crop and rearrange their pages using an interactive and intuitive graphical interface. This question came up in a framemaker class recently. Split pdf file into pieces or pick just a few pages. Earlier this year, a new package called tabulizer was released in r, which allows you to automatically pull out tables and text from pdfs. Split multipage pdfs into single page pdfs on gnulinux. Splitting pdf to make multiple pdfs less than 20mb stack overflow. Split pdf file into individual pages using vba solved. How to split a pdf into pages using vba vba visual basic. This program illustrates some of the main features of python. This online vb tutorial aims to illustrate the process of pdf document splitting. Pdfsplit formally named pdfslice is a python commandline tool and module for splitting and rearranging pages of a pdf document.
But there is a lovely free software way to do it, so you would be sor. How to split a pdf into pages using vba fumei technicaluser 25 mar 09. Press split button and download a zipped archive of the output pdfs. I thought my python script might be useful to someone. Split pdf pdf split into multiple files online free. In the previous articles we gave an introduction into reading pdf documents using python. Its a command line utility that you can call from python. Splitting an empty string with a specified separator returns. Its a question that comes up more often than you would think. Next we open the pdf up and create a reader object. For the latter, select the pages you wish to extract. With that version, it supports subsetting, merging, rotating and modifying data in pdfs. This article is the beginning of a little series, and will cover these helpful python libraries.
Building a pdf splitter application practical business python. Click delete on each page to remove the ones that you dont want. If sep is not specified or is none, a different splitting algorithm is applied. The continue reading creating and manipulating pdfs. Choose to extract every page into a pdf or select pages to extract. Youll also learn how to merge, split, watermark, and rotate pages in pdfs using python and pypdf2. Split pdf split the pdf into multiple files free online.
You have the chance to delete the splitted pages and to open them from the gui directly. It doesnt construct an inmemory list and exhaust all the input iterators before. Dragging and dropping files to the page also works. Splitting and merging pdfs with python the mouse vs. I recently had the need to take a couple pages out of a pdf and save it. With so many tools for you to use, you can easily split pdf pages, extract pages from pdf, merge and compress pdfs, convert a variety of file types to pdf, and convert pdf files into file types such as word, excel, and more. How to merge two pages into a single page inside a pdf. Natural language processing with python data science association. I think i understand your question better than the ones who answered your question below. Net developers an easy to use solution that they can split target multi page pdf document file to one page pdf files or they can separate source pdf file to smaller pdf documents by every given number of pages.
The following are code examples for showing how to use ntpath. To do this you describe these pages with the simple python slice notation, e. There was possibly over 100 pdf files in the directory and each pdf could have one to more than ten pages. A while ago i uploaded a document using python and matplotlib to create profile graphs and recently there was a question about how to create a pdf with multiple graphs on a single page. This article is part three of a little series on working with pdfs in python. The pdfrw package is a pure python library that you can use to read and write pdf files. When maxsplit is specified, the list will contain the specified number of elements plus one. The page ordering in the scanned pdf is not the natural one.
It knows enough about these to perform scaling, rotation, and positioning. The pypdf2 package gives you the ability to split up a single pdf into multiple ones. Of course you could point some proprietary software at it, or you could do the job by hand. Inserting, deleting, and reordering pages you are here introduction. The first line of this function will grab the name of the input file, minus the extension. The video describes how one could write a code to split pdf files using python. The portable document format or pdf is a file format that can be used to present and exchange documents reliably across operating systems.
Im trying to get the content of a web page that is written in pdf format. Printing to the screen or writing to a disk file are side effects, for example. Is there a nice way to split a multi page pdf into its constituent pages. There is no standard way provided by adobe acrobat which i could find to join merge two. Python practice book, release 20140810 the operators can be combined. How to split a pdf in single pages pdf with python and tkinter. Choose page ranges from the original document which you wish to include in each split file. Split every page in a pdf i a different pdf python. For an example of the latter case, if you have a one page pdf containing a watermark, you can layer it onto each page of another pdf. So far you have learned how to manipulate existing pdfs, and to read and extract the content both text.
Hello everyone i have the following working code that merge pdf files into one file using acrobat pro reference. You can work with a preexisting pdf in python by using the pypdf2 package. In part one we will focus on the manipulation of existing pdfs. Ive just scanned in some old copies of trail walking magazine. My code is writing the first five file names correctly, but stops after incorrectly naming the second group. The challenge i am facing is that all the pages are not of the same size so some. For example, this error might be raised if a peruser quota is exhausted, or perhaps the entire file system is out of space. Split pdf into single files using python code, split any given pdf into single files at the destination folder. Say youve created a pdf with transparent watermark text using photoshop, gimp, or latex. Creating multiple graphs per page using matplotlib. I want to deconstruct the big pdf into saparate pages and extract them saparately. To split the document and then reorder the page back to their natural order theres a handy option you can select.